Undercover Watch in Glenrothes

Officers from the National Crime Agency teamed up with Police Scotland to keep a close eye on Mohammed Asif, 50, from Glenrothes, and Fikret Ugurlu, 40, from Wembley, London. The pair met in a car park in Glenrothes on 7 February 2022, under police surveillance.

Crackdown on Drug Supply

Detective Chief Inspector Steven Elliot said: “This conviction and sentencing highlight our relentless fight against drug supply and distribution across Scotland. Targeting organised crime remains our top priority.”

Communities Play Key Role

DCI Elliot urged the public to come forward with information, stressing that local tips are vital to investigations. He added: “Your information helps us disrupt the drugs trade and bring offenders to justice.”
